How to Clean Mattress: The Ultimate Guide


Greetings, Challenger! It’s a fact that we spend about one-third of our lives sleeping, making our beds and mattresses vital components of our lives. However, despite this importance, mattresses tend to accumulate dirt, germs, and other impurities over time, leading to the need for frequent cleaning. But, do you know how to clean mattress effectively without damaging it? In this guide, we take you through the process of cleaning your mattress, step by step.

Why you should clean your mattress

Mattress cleaning forms an essential part of preserving the life of your bedding. Mattresses carry bacteria, dust mites, dead skin cells, and sweat, which can cause health problems and trigger allergies. Cleaning your mattress prolongs its life and improves its hygienic nature. Besides, it helps you get a good night’s sleep by providing a clean, fresh, and healthy sleeping environment.

Precautions before cleaning your mattress

Before you start cleaning your mattress, there are a few precautions you should take.

Top precautions to take when cleaning your mattress

Precautions Reasons
Remove all bedding To expose the surface and clean it more easily
Check for any stains To focus on targeted cleaning
Ensure the mattress is dry To avoid moisture retention and fungal growth
Allow fresh air to circulate To reduce dampness and musty odor

How to clean mattress

Now that you have taken the necessary precautions let’s dive into how you can clean your mattress.

Step 1: Vacuum the mattress

The first step in cleaning a mattress is to use a vacuum cleaner to remove dust, dirt, and hair. A handheld vacuum with strong suction abilities can be helpful in removing debris accumulated on the surface. You should concentrate on the seams, edges of the mattress, and crevices where dust accumulates. Vacuum both sides of the mattress thoroughly.

Step 2: Spot Clean Stains

Mattresses tend to have stains from sweat, spilled drinks, and other fluids. These stains can affect the appearance and hygiene of your beddings. To spot clean stains, you need to make a paste of baking soda and water, and apply it to the stain. Leave the paste on the stain for 15-20 minutes, then blot it with a dry cloth or sponge.

Step 3: Deodorize the Mattress

Your mattress can develop an unpleasant odor over time, especially if not cleaned regularly. A simple yet effective solution to this problem is to sprinkle baking soda generously on the mattress and leave it overnight. In the morning, vacuum the excess soda. Your mattress will smell fresh and clean.

Step 4: Use a Mattress Protector

Once you have cleaned and deodorized your mattress, it’s also important to take measures to prevent any future dirt or stains from accumulating. A mattress protector is an excellent way to shield your bedding from spills, dirt, and perspiration. A waterproof mattress protector is ideal for people with babies, small children or elderly family members who typically have problems with bedwetting or incontinence.

Step 5: Flip the Mattress

Flipping a mattress allows for even wear and tear, reducing strain on one side. Additionally, flipping your mattress can promote even distribution of body weight, therefore helping to prevent the development of sags and dips that could lead to back pain. To flip your mattress, you need to remove all bedding and support the mattress while rotating it 180 degrees. For one-sided mattresses, you can rotate them 180 degrees.

Step 6: Air Dry Thoroughly

After cleaning your mattress, ensure it is completely dry before placing the bedding on it. Sundries an excellent way of achieving this, especially if you live in a dry and warm climate. However, if you reside in a humid area, using a fan or air conditioner to make the mattress dry faster is advisable.

Step 7: Replace the Bedding

With your mattress now clean, fresh, and well-aired, it’s time to return the bedding to the bed. Be sure to use clean sheets and pillowcases, as well as a freshly laundered mattress protector.

Frequently Asked Questions

How often should I clean my mattress?

You should clean your mattress at least once every six months. However, if you have pets or suffer from allergies, you may need to clean your mattress more frequently.

Can I use bleach to clean my mattress?

No, you should not use bleach to clean your mattress as it can damage the fabrics and fibers. Sodium hypochlorite found in bleach can also weaken the fabric of the mattress, making it prone to tearing and pilling.

How can I remove bed bugs from my mattress?

To remove bed bugs from your mattress, you first need to vacuum the mattress thoroughly. Then, apply Diatomaceous Earth to the bed frame, around the skirting, and any other common hiding places of bed bugs. Leave the Diatomaceous Earth undisturbed in pest-infested areas for 4-5 days. This process should kill off bed bugs, eggs, and larvae.

Can I dry clean my mattress?

No, you should not dry clean your mattress. Dry cleaning requires the use of harsh chemicals that can harm the mattress’s fabrics and fibers.

How can I prevent molds from forming on my mattress?

To prevent molds from forming on your mattress, you should ensure that your room is appropriately ventilated, and the humidity level is low. Using a dehumidifier in humid climates can also help. Also, ensure that your bedding is dry before placing it on the bed.

Can I steam-clean my mattress?

Yes, you can steam-clean your mattress. Steam cleaning uses heat and water to clean the mattress deeply without damaging the fabric or fibers.

How long do I need to leave the baking soda on my mattress?

You should leave the baking soda on your mattress for at least eight hours or overnight.

How can I remove urine stains from my mattress?

To remove urine stains from your mattress, apply a mixture of hydrogen peroxide and baking soda to the stain. Leave the paste for at least an hour before blotting with a dry cloth or sponge. For tougher stains, add vinegar to the mixture.

Can I use a carpet cleaner to clean my mattress?

No, you should not use a carpet cleaner to clean your mattress. Carpet cleaners are formulated for carpets, and using them on a mattress can damage it.

Can I use essential oils to deodorize my mattress?

Yes, you can use essential oils to refresh your mattress. Mix a few drops of essential oil with water and put the mixture in a spray bottle. Spray the essential oils mixture on your mattress and let it air dry.

How can I remove blood stains from my mattress?

To remove blood stains from your mattress, mix baking soda and cold water, and then apply it to the stain. Leave the paste for 30 minutes before blotting with a dry cloth or sponge.

Can I use a vacuum cleaner with a beater bar on my mattress?

No, you should not use a vacuum cleaner with a beater bar on your mattress. The beater bar can damage the fabric and cause pilling. Use a handheld vacuum with a soft brush attachment instead.

Why do I need a mattress protector?

A mattress protector shields your bedding from sweat, perspiration, dirt, and spills. By using a mattress protector, you can extend the life of your mattress and maintain its hygiene.


In conclusion, taking good care of your mattress is critical in ensuring that you get the best sleep experience. Cleaning your mattress should be a regular part of your cleaning routine. Follow the steps outlined above, and you will restore your mattress to its pristine condition. The benefits of frequently cleaning your mattress are endless, from preventing allergies and keeping a fresh scent to prolonged longevity. Take advantage of these tips, and get to work cleaning your mattress today, Challenger!


The information provided in this article is only intended for informational purposes. It should not be used as a substitute for professional advice, diagnosis or treatment. Always seek the advice of a qualified professional before making any changes to your life.